    Skilled nursing facilities (SNFs) provide high-level medical care and rehabilitation for short-term recovery, typically covered by Medicare after hospitalization, while nursing homes focus on ongoing custodial care for chronic conditions, mainly funded by Medicaid or private payments. The staffing and regulatory structures differ significantly between the two, necessitating clarity for families in choosing appropriate long-term care options.

    Nursing home care costs in the U.S. vary significantly based on location, level of care, and amenities, with private room prices ranging from approximately $6,700 to over $30,000 monthly. Families need to explore various payment options and conduct thorough research to manage these expenses effectively.

    Nonmedical home care provides assistance with daily activities and companionship for individuals wishing to maintain independence and quality of life at home, without medical intervention. Its growing popularity is driven by an aging population, the need for supportive environments for recovery, and the emotional benefits of caregiver companionship, while costs vary based on service frequency and location.
